A Few Things to Talk About While Coloring

Coloring time can also be a nice opportunity to talk about turtles.

You can explain that a turtle's shell helps protect its body and that different turtles live in different environments. Some live on land, while sea turtles spend much of their time in the ocean.

For younger kids, keep it simple with questions like:

“Where does your turtle live?”
“What should we name it?”
“What color should its shell be?”

You might be surprised by the answers!
